Atlasova, northern Kuril Islands

The small island of Atlasova (Остров Атласова) is a member of the Northern Kuril Islands, being located 22 km off the northwest coast of its larger neighbour of Paramushir. The island, sometimes referred to as Alaid (after its volcano of the same name), has an area of 153 km².

The island, which sits westwards from the main northeast to southwest trending line of the Kuril Islands, is the tallest and northernmost volcano to be found in the Kuril Islands. The centrally located, symmetrical cone of Vulkan Alaid reaches a height of 2,339 m. The explosive activity of 1790 and 1981 were amongst the largest recorded volcanic eruptions to be experienced in the Kuril Islands.
